Développeur API Mulesoft

CDI

  • Levallois-Perret, Île de France, France (92)
  • Aix-en-Provence, Provence-Alpes-Côte d’Azur, France (13)
  • Moirans, Auvergne-Rhône-Alpes (38)

En fonction de votre séniorité, sous la supervision d’un SAM ou Tech Lead Developer, le développeur Mulesoft joue un rôle crucial dans l’implémentation et le support des solutions Mulesoft.

Vos rôles et réponsabilités :

  • Mettre en œuvre la réalisation technique sur les solutions Mulesoft et associées (Splunk, Datadog, AWS, …) en fonction des projets.
  • Participation active à l’optimisation des processus d’intégration pour améliorer l’efficacité et la performance.
  • Collaborer étroitement avec les Business Analysts, Project Managers, et Technical Leads pour comprendre les exigences techniques et métier.
  • Participer à la conception, au développement, et à la configuration des solutions Mulesoft.
  • Réaliser des tests, formations et participer activement aux tâches de DevOps selon la séniorité.
  • Épauler les équipes sur des projets d’envergure et prendre des responsabilités de Solution Architect sur des projets plus simples.
  • Assurer la qualité et la performance des solutions développées, y compris la gestion des erreurs et la tolérance aux pannes.

Vos forces et compétences doivent inclure les éléments suivants :

  • Une solide connaissance des produits Mulesoft et une veille technologique continue.
  • Maîtrise des concepts d’intégration, SOA, API security, et des protocoles de messagerie comme JMS et Anypoint MQ.
  • Expérience en développement d’API RESTful, programmation en Dataweave, Java, JavaScript, Python, et autres langages pertinents.
  • Familiarité avec les bases de données SQL et NoSQL, et capacité à concevoir des architectures d’intégration efficaces.
  • Compétences en gestion de projet, en animation de workshops, et en accompagnement de clients ou de consultants juniors.
  • Capacité à guider et mentoriser les membres juniors de l’équipe dans le développement de leurs compétences techniques et professionnelles.
  • Expérience avec des outils de CI/CD (Continuous Integration/Continuous Deployment) pour automatiser les processus de déploiement.
  • Compétences avancées en résolution de problèmes complexes et en fournissant des solutions innovantes.
  • Connaissance approfondie des dernières tendances technologiques dans le domaine de l’intégration et de l’automatisation.
  • Excellente maîtrise de l’anglais, à l’écrit comme à l’oral.
Scroll Up